如何在 web.xml 文件中配置应用程序的参数,例如 servlet、servlet 映射、过滤器、监听器等等。
时间: 2024-05-10 11:18:37 浏览: 52
在web.xml文件中,可以使用以下元素来配置应用程序的参数:
1. servlet元素:用于定义一个Servlet类和它的映射。
```
<servlet>
<servlet-name>MyServlet</servlet-name>
<servlet-class>com.example.MyServlet</servlet-class>
</servlet>
```
2. servlet-mapping元素:用于将一个Servlet类映射到一个URL模式。
```
<servlet-mapping>
<servlet-name>MyServlet</servlet-name>
<url-pattern>/myservlet/*</url-pattern>
</servlet-mapping>
```
3. filter元素:用于定义一个Filter类和它的映射。
```
<filter>
<filter-name>MyFilter</filter-name>
<filter-class>com.example.MyFilter</filter-class>
</filter>
```
4. filter-mapping元素:用于将一个Filter类映射到一个URL模式。
```
<filter-mapping>
<filter-name>MyFilter</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
```
5. listener元素:用于定义一个监听器。
```
<listener>
<listener-class>com.example.MyListener</listener-class>
</listener>
```
6. context-param元素:用于定义一个应用程序级别的参数。
```
<context-param>
<param-name>myParam</param-name>
<param-value>myValue</param-value>
</context-param>
```
阅读全文